服务热线 400-660-8066

南昌网站建设
首页 站内资讯

南昌网站建设

站内资讯
南昌网站建设 / 站内资讯 / 行业资讯 / 正文

中企动力:以下是为您生成的一篇文案,

来源: All文章
发布时间:2025-04-11 17:22:07

网站设计背景图片代码解析">网站设计背景图片代码解析

在如今竞争激烈的网络时代,一个吸引人的网站不仅能提升用户体验,还能增强品牌的视觉形象。而网站设计中的一个重要元素就是背景图片。合理使用背景图片能为网站增添美感和吸引力,而背后的代码实现则是这一效果的关键。本文将深入探讨网站设计中背景图片的代码实现方法及其重要性。

1. 背景图片的意义与作用

背景图片不仅仅是美化网站的装饰元素,它在用户体验中扮演着至关重要的角色。一个好的背景图片可以引导用户的视线,突出重要内容,甚至可以传达品牌的情感和价值观。此外,背景图片还可以增加网页的层次感和深度,使页面看起来更加生动和立体,提高用户的停留时间和参与度。

2. CSS中的background属性

在网站设计中,CSS(层叠样式表)是控制网页外观的核心工具之一。CSS中的background属性允许我们为网页元素添加背景图片。其基本语法如下:

element {
background-image: url('路径到你的图像文件');
background-repeat: no-repeat; /* 禁止重复 */
background-position: center center; /* 居中对齐 */
background-size: cover; /* 覆盖整个容器 */
}

上述代码示例中,url('路径到你的图像文件')指定了背景图片的位置;background-repeat: no-repeat确保图片不会重复出现;background-position: center center让背景图在元素中居中显示;而background-size: cover则使背景图片覆盖整个元素区域,同时保持图片的长宽比。

3. HTML5中设置背景图片

除了通过CSS设置背景图片外,HTML5也提供了一些方式来嵌入背景图片。最常见的方法是直接在HTML元素的style属性中使用内联CSS:

<div style="background-image: url('images/background.jpg');">
<!-- 其他内容 -->
</div>

这种方法适用于简单的网页设计或快速原型制作。然而,对于更复杂的项目,建议使用外部CSS文件以保持代码的整洁和可维护性。

4. 响应式设计中的背景图片

随着移动设备的普及,响应式设计成为了现代网站设计的必要条件。为了使背景图片在不同设备上都能保持良好的视觉效果,我们需要确保图片能够根据屏幕大小进行调整。幸运的是,CSS3为我们提供了强大的媒体查询功能,可以根据不同的屏幕尺寸调整样式:

/* 默认样式 */
body {
background-image: url('large-background.jpg');
}
/* 针对小屏设备优化 */
@media (max-width: 768px) {
body {
background-image: url('small-background.jpg');
}
}

在这个例子中,当屏幕宽度小于或等于768像素时,网页会加载一个较小的背景图片,以确保加载速度和显示效果。

5. 性能考虑与优化技巧

虽然背景图片可以显著增强网站的视觉体验,但它们也可能影响网页的加载时间和性能。为了优化性能,我们可以采取以下措施:

  • 选择合适的格式:JPEG适合照片类图片,PNG适合图标和透明图片,WEBP则是新兴的高效格式。
  • 压缩图片:利用工具如TinyPNG或ImageOptim来减小图片文件的大小。
  • 懒加载:对于非首屏内容的图片,可以使用懒加载技术延迟加载,以加快初始页面载入速度。
  • 使用CDN:通过内容分发网络(CDN)分发图片,可以提高全球用户的访问速度。 合理运用背景图片及其代码实现不仅可以美化网站,还能提升用户体验和品牌形象。通过掌握CSS和HTML的相关技术,并结合响应式设计和性能优化策略,设计师们能够创造出既美观又高效的网页作品。
* 文章来源于网络,如有侵权,请联系客服删除处理。
在线 咨询

添加动力小姐姐微信

微信 咨询

电话咨询

400-660-8066

我们联系您

电话 咨询
微信扫码关注动力小姐姐 X
qr